VANCOUVER, British Columbia, June 10, 2020 -- Solstice Gold Corp. (TSXV: SGC) (“Solstice” or the “Company”) is pleased to announce that, further to the Company’s news release dated May 25, 2020, the Company has closed, subject to receipt of final approval from the TSX Venture Exchange (“TSXV”), its non-brokered private placement financing for total proceeds of $1,198,786.64 (the “Private Placement”). 

The Private Placement consisted the issuance by the Company of: (i) a total of 29,969,666 units (the “Units”), at a price of at $0.04 per Unit,  with each Unit comprising one common share of the Company and one common share purchase warrant.  Each full warrant entitles the holder thereof to purchase one additional common share of the Company at a price of $0.06 for a period of 36 months from the closing of the Private Placement.   All securities issued pursuant to the Private Placement are subject to a four-month hold period in accordance  with applicable Canadian securities laws and are also subject to the Exchange Hold Period (as defined by the TSXV rules) and have been legended accordingly.

The proceeds from the Private Placement will be used as follows: (i) $800,000 in respect of exploration and related expenditures; and (ii) $398,786 in respect of general corporate, working capital and future exploration programs. Although the Company intends to use the proceeds of the Private Placement as described herein, the actual allocation of proceeds may vary, depending on future operations, events or opportunities; provided however, in no circumstance will any proceeds of the Private Placement be utilized by the Company to pay Investor Relations Activities or any Related Parties payments (as each such term is defined by the TSXV rules), all in accordance with certain temporary relief measures established by the TSXV on April 8, 2020 in response to the COVID-19 pandemic.

Board Changes

Upon closing of the Private Placement, the board of directors of the Company (the “Solstice Board”) has been reorganized as follows: (i) the number of directors has been increased from five to six; (ii) Marty Tunney and Chad Ulansky have both resigned as members of the Solstice Board; and (iii) Kevin Reid, Michael Gentile and Blair Schultz have been appointed as new members of the Solstice Board.  Mr. Tunney will continue in his role as President of the Company and Mr. Ulansky has been retained by the Company as a consultant.  The Company thanks them both for their contributions as founding directors of the Company and looks forward to their continuing roles with the Company.  Board appointments remain subject to regulatory approvals.

About Solstice Gold

Solstice is a gold-focussed exploration company engaged in the exploration of its 866 km2 (100%) district scale KGP and certain other rights covering an adjacent 683 km2, all with no underlying option or earn in payments. KGP is located in Nunavut, Canada only 26 km from Rankin Inlet and only 15 km from the Meliadine gold deposits owned by Agnico Eagle Mines Ltd. Solstice has 99.5 million shares outstanding.
